What does the symbol zero or o with a diagonal line through it mean?

In mathematics, an empty set is a unique set having no elements inside it. Its size (which is based on the number of elements inside it) is also zero.

The empty set is sometimes called a null set as well.

Empty set is given the notation of o with a diagonal line through it as shown in the attached picture.

What is the area of a rectangle that has side lengths of 3/4 yard and 5/6 yard
Ahat [919]

We are asked to find the area of the rectangle that has side lengths of 3/4 yard and 5/6 yard.

We know that area of rectangle is width times length.

To find the area of the given rectangle we will multiply both side lengths as:

\text{Area of rectangle}=\text{Width}\times \text{Length}

\text{Area of rectangle}=\frac{3}{4}\text{ yard}\times\frac{5}{6}\text{ yard}

\text{Area of rectangle}=\frac{3}{4}\times\frac{5}{6}\text{ yard}^2

\text{Area of rectangle}=\frac{1}{4}\times\frac{5}{2}\text{ yard}^2

\text{Area of rectangle}=\frac{1\times5}{4\times2}\text{ yard}^2

\text{Area of rectangle}=\frac{5}{8}\text{ yard}^2

Therefore, the area of the given rectangle would be \frac{5}{8} square yards.
